Profile
Mr. Harling specializes in structural engineering with an emphasis on failure investigations and maintenance activities (inspection, acceptance) of antenna carriers since 1995. His experience includes investigations about flaws and failures of all kinds of antenna carriers, in detail concrete towers (large TV-towers / radio towers), prestressed centrifugally concrete masts, steel masts (lattice and tube). He is also an expert for the special requirements of the extension of existing tower structures (chimneys, wind power stations) with antennas. His background is basing on numerous static calculations, design reviews and assessment of structural behaviour of tower structures using nonlinear static and dynamic analysis techniques. Mr. Harling is doing his doctorate about „ Design of centrifugally concrete masts - Close to reality limitation of cracking and deformation” at the Technical University of Dortmund, Germany. Since 2009 he is also state registered expert for antenna carrier structures (publicy appointed and sworn by the “Ingenieurkammer Bau NRW”, March 2009).
